2009-05-08 6 views
1

Ist es möglich, eine andere ODBC-Datenbank zu aktualisieren, wenn Sie eine gespeicherte SQL Server-Prozedur verwenden. Angenommen, ich habe Zugriff, MySQL usw. Ich aktualisiere meine SQL Server-Datenbank und möchte, dass die gespeicherte Prozedur die andere ODBC-Datenbank aktualisiert. Ein bisschen wie die Replikation eines armen Mannes.Kann ich eine SQL Server-Datenbank innerhalb einer gespeicherten SQL Server-Prozedur aktualisieren?

Gibt es eine bessere Möglichkeit, zwischen verschiedenen Datenbanksystemen zu replizieren?

Vielen Dank für jede Hilfe.

Antwort

3

Das Hinzufügen eines Verbindungsservers sollte Ihr Problem lösen. Sie haben die Wahl zwischen Anbietern, einschließlich ODBC.

http://msdn.microsoft.com/en-us/library/ms188279.aspx

+0

Danke. Können Sie jetzt keine .net-Sprachen in SPs verwenden? Können sie ODBC verwenden? – johnny

+0

Sie können. Ich benutze es erfolgreich mit der Software, die ich in meinem Job schreibe. Wenn Sie interessiert sind, besuchen Sie die SQLCLR: http://msdn.microsoft.com/en-us/library/ms345136.aspx – hunterjrj

Verwandte Themen